Transaction 51b284433f707d875836840053153d99c0d0b243e17db896b13cf1524f7ad724

1 Input
2 Outputs
  • 51b284433f707d875836840053153d99c0d0b243e17db896b13cf1524f7ad724:0
  • value  16505087
    address  1KKtHEFL7s8nJqJBsqziL8T1npZvr9hpHi
  • 51b284433f707d875836840053153d99c0d0b243e17db896b13cf1524f7ad724:1
  • value  726688955
    address  bc1qy5k7usg0xa4lynnmndlzexkg0xda4udzk8z4yv